科技的飞速发展,逐渐走进了我们的视野。比特币作为一种去中心化的,吸引了无数投资者的关注。而比特币加密数据的方式,更是让人们对它产生了浓厚兴趣。那么,比特币究竟是如何加密数据的呢?本文将为介绍这一神秘过程。
一、比特币加密概述
比特币采用了一种名为“椭圆曲线加密”的技术,确保交易数据的安全性和匿名性。椭圆曲线加密算法是一种公钥密码学算法,具有较高的安全性和效率。
二、椭圆曲线加密原理
1、 密钥生成
椭圆曲线加密的核心是生成密钥。我们需要选择一个椭圆曲线,并确定其基点。基点是一个特殊的点,它具有初露性。一系列数算,我们椭圆曲线上生成一个私钥。私钥是一个随机数,它是进行加密和解密的关键。
2、 公钥生成
得到私钥后,我们特定的算法计算出公钥。公钥是由私钥和椭圆曲线上的基点数算得到。公钥公开,因为任何人都使用它来加密信息。
3、 加密和解密
当一方想要发送加密信息时,他会使用接收方的公钥来加密信息。加密后的信息只有拥有相应私钥的人才能解密。这样,算传输过程中信息被截获,他人也无法解读。
三、比特币加密的优势
1、 安全性
比特币采用椭圆曲线加密,其安全性极高。算计算机运算速度再快,椭圆曲线加密也是几乎不的。
2、 匿名性
椭圆曲线加密保护用户。用户发送交易时,使用公钥进行加密,确保交易信息的匿名性。
3、 扩展性
比特币的加密技术具有较高的扩展性。区块链技术的发展,椭圆曲线加密应用于更多场景。
四、比特币加密的应用
1、 交易验证
比特币交易过程中,需要使用加密技术来验证交易双方的身份和交易信息。只有验证,交易才能被确认为有效。
2、 资产保护
比特币的加密技术保护用户资产,防止被盗。算账户被盗,他人也无法读取其中的信息。
3、 数字身份认证
椭圆曲线加密技术应用于数字身份认证领域,提高认证的安全性。
比特币的加密方式为的发展提供了保障。区块链技术的不断成熟,我们期待比特币加密技术未来发挥更大作用。
版权说明:本文章来源于网络信息 ,不作为本网站提供的投资理财建议或其他任何类型的建议。 投资有风险,入市须谨慎。